Vulnerability in /N Software Ipworks Ssh Sftpserver
CVE-2024-6580
The /n software IPWorks SSH library SFTPServer component can be induced to make unintended filesystem or network path requests when loading a SSH public key or certificate. To be exploitable, an application calling the SFTPServer component…
